Jamaica - Export of Breathing Appliances and Gas Masks

Since 2012, Jamaica Export of Breathing Appliances and Gas Masks was down by 18.3% year on year. In 2017, the country was ranked number 120 among other countries in Export of Breathing Appliances and Gas Masks at $938.76. Jamaica is overtaken by Iceland, which was ranked number 119 with $1,437.2 and is followed by Saint Vincent and the Grenadines with $909.01. United States topped the ranking with $410,133,393.07 in 2019, a fall of 0.1% versus 2018. Germany, United Kingdom and France resp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Nicaragua recorded the best 5 years average growth at +308.8% per year, while Aruba witnessed the worst performance at -82.6% per year.
